[0025] The technical solutions of the present invention will be described in further detail below with reference to the accompanying drawings and embodiments.

[0026] The present invention is different from using single-frequency sound or narrow-band noise as the masking signal source in the prior art, but uses natural sounds such as running water, forest, and birdsong as the masking signal source, so that the wearer's hearing experience is better while masking the tinnitus. For comfort, I am more willing to wear it for a long time, so as to achieve a better effect of relieving tinnitus. Using linear frequency shifting technology, personalized masking signals can be generated according to the needs of different tinnitus patients, while avoiding complicated calculation methods, and can be realized with simple and relatively cheap equipment, which will benefit more tinnitus patients. The system has high control precision and stable performance.

Abstract

The invention relates to a tinnitus treatment device and a masking sound signal synthesizing method. The tinnitus treatment device comprises a signal control module, a signal processing module and a signal output module. The signal control module selects a masking sound type according to basic masking signals, determines a tinnitus frequency band and controls the volume of masking sound. The signal processing module determines a target frequency band according to the tinnitus frequency, moves the frequency band of the masking sound to a frequency band with the central frequency of the target frequency band as the center and synthesizes masking sound signals. The signal output module outputs the volume of the masking sound signals according to the volume of the masking sound. The device can reduce the disturbance degree of masking sound while remitting tinnitus; the tinnitus treatment device is simple to use and low in cost and meets the requirements of more patients with tinnitus; the tinnitus treatment device also improves the difference masking control precision.

Description

technical field [0001] The present invention relates to a device for treating or alleviating tinnitus, in particular to a tinnitus treatment device and a method for synthesizing masking sound signals. Background technique [0002] The causes of tinnitus are very complicated, and currently there is no specific drug or surgical treatment for tinnitus. There are two main types of tinnitus treatment methods currently used: tinnitus masking therapy and habituation therapy. Tinnitus masking therapy is to use other external sounds to mask the tinnitus and reduce the impact of tinnitus on the patient. Masking effects are divided into active mitigation and passive mitigation. The so-called active relief refers to the disappearance of tinnitus during the sounding period; the passive relief refers to the disappearance of tinnitus after the masking ends.
